Brookdale to launch Achieve Academy for Adults with Autism on Monday

(WALL, NJ) -- Thomas A. Arnone, Director of the Monmouth County Commissioners, and Dr. David Stout, President of Brookdale Community College, will hold a ribbon-cutting ceremony for  the official launch of the Achieve Academy for Adults with Autism on Monday, July 15, 2024 at 9:30am at Brookdale Community College Wall Campus, located at 800 Monmouth Blvd, in Wall Township, NJ.

The Achieve Academy addresses the critical gap in services and educational opportunities for adults with Autism once they attain 21 years of age and public-school services end. Parents often navigate a confusing maze of options in search of services for their adult children. It can be particularly challenging and costly for families to find high-quality continuing education programs and securing essential services, such as speech, occupational, physical, and behavioral therapies. The Achieve Academy aims to alleviate these burdens by providing comprehensive support and resources to help adults with Autism thrive in their communities. Through employer partnerships, job coaching, specialized training programs, and life-skills training, the Achieve Academy will also assist clients in developing the skills to work and live independently or with the support of an aide.

Director Arnone expressed his excitement about the launch of the Achieve Academy, stating, "The opening of the Achieve Academy represents a significant milestone in our commitment to supporting individuals with Autism and their families. This program will provide essential services and opportunities, helping adults with Autism lead fulfilling, independent lives."

The Achieve Academy for Adults with Autism is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ization that is supported through the fundraising efforts of the Achieve Academy Board of Directors, led by Chairman Gary Goldfarb, Vice Chairman Thomas A. Arnone, Shaun Golden, and Dr. Tara Beams.  Brookdale Community College provides access to the Wall Campus East Building where the Academy will operate and employs the Academy Director, Linda Jordan.
